History Foundation Announces $135,000 in Grants Available in 2021

 

November 4, 2020



The Montana History Foundation will place $135,000 in preservation grants throughout the state during its upcoming 2021 grant cycle, which opens November 1st.

The Foundation will provide grants up to $10,000 for projects that help preserve and protect Montana’s history.
